History & UNESCO Significance
The Churches and Convents of Goa date back to the 16th century when this region became a significant center for the spread of Christianity in India by the Portuguese colonial empire. Recognized by UNESCO for its historical and cultural importance, this site showcases an impressive collection of baroque churches and convents, including the Basilica of Bom Jesus, which houses the remains of St. Francis Xavier. The stunning architecture, intricate interiors, and serene ambiance reflect a blend of Indian and European influences, making this site a fascinating glimpse into Goa’s rich past.
